ExtraHop Networks, Inc., commonly known as ExtraHop, is a leading provider of cloud-native network detection and response solutions. Headquartered in the United States, the company has established a significant presence in major operational regions across North America and Europe. Founded in 2007, ExtraHop has achieved notable milestones, including recognition as a pioneer in real-time analytics for IT operations and security. The company’s core offerings include its Reveal(x) platform, which uniquely combines machine learning and advanced analytics to provide deep visibility into network traffic. This innovative approach enables organisations to detect threats, optimise performance, and enhance security posture. In 2022, EXTRAHOP reported total carbon emissions of approximately 248,116,000 kg CO2e. This figure includes 15,500,000 kg CO2e from Scope 1 emissions, 232,616,000 kg CO2e from Scope 2 emissions, and 259,585,000 kg CO2e from Scope 3 emissions, which encompasses business travel, employee commuting, and the use of sold products. The emissions data shows a trend of increasing total emissions over the years, with 2021 emissions at about 234,767,000 kg CO2e and 2020 at approximately 182,622,000 kg CO2e. Notably, the Scope 2 emissions have consistently constituted the majority of their total emissions, indicating a significant reliance on purchased electricity. Despite the rising emissions, there are currently no publicly disclosed reduction targets or climate pledges from EXTRAHOP. This absence of specific commitments highlights a potential area for improvement in their climate strategy, especially as industry standards increasingly favour companies with clear and actionable climate goals.
